To display the layout on the monitor, do the following:
Click the + button on the non-distributed additional video monitor's thumbnail. The additional monitor becomes active, and the layout of the main monitor will be duplicated on it.
Configure the layout of an additional monitor (see Configuring layouts). You can configure the layout of the additional monitor through the main monitor (the additional monitor must be active). Changes affect only the additional monitor; the layout of the main monitor is not changed.
Click the main monitor's thumbnail. The additional monitor becomes inactive, and the original layout is displayed on the main monitor. If the additional monitor becomes inactive, editing of the layout does not affect it.
To display a camera selected on the main monitor on the additional monitor, do the following:
Click the button on the non-distributed additional video monitor.
- Selecting a camera on the main monitor makes its video feed visible on the additional monitor.
